In 1991, Indian economy was liberalized in a big way. In this financial liberalization, our study is focused on ascertaining trends due to structural reforms affected in the life insurance industry. The present study explains the concept of market micro structure. It also elaborates upon the concept of insurance from three perspectives and incorporates the risk management process. The main emphasis of the study is to ascertain the growth trends of variables peculiar to life insurance industry. The study reveals a growth and graphical analysis of life insurance penetration, life insurance density, new policies issued, first year premium and total life insurance premium and shows that insurance industry has been on a growth path as all the above mentioned variables have shown a consistent rise.
